Understanding AI-Generated Text

AI tools, such as ChatGPT, generate text using sophisticated algorithms that analyze vast amounts of data to produce coherent and contextually relevant content. These tools rely on patterns in the data they've been trained on, making their output often appear polished and fluent. However, there are telltale signs that can help identify AI-generated text.

AI-generated text often lacks the nuances of genuine human writing. For example, while AI can produce grammatically correct sentences, it may struggle with complex or abstract concepts. It might also produce text that is overly verbose or excessively uniform in tone. Recognizing these patterns is the first step in detecting AI-generated content.

Common Indicators of AI-Generated Text

1. Overly Formal or Consistent Tone

AI tools often produce text with a consistent tone, which can sometimes come off as overly formal or robotic. Unlike human writers who naturally vary their style and tone depending on the context and audience, AI-generated text may maintain a uniform style throughout. This consistency can be a sign of artificial generation.

2. Lack of Deep Insight or Originality

AI-generated content tends to be less insightful and original. While AI can synthesize information from various sources, it may not offer new perspectives or deep analysis. If the text lacks personal anecdotes, original ideas, or unique insights, it might be generated by an AI.

3. Repetitive Phrasing and Structure

AI tools can sometimes produce repetitive phrasing or follow similar sentence structures throughout the text. This repetitiveness can be a clue that the content is machine-generated. Human writers typically vary their sentence structures and word choices more frequently.

4. Inaccuracies or Factual Errors

AI tools may produce text with factual inaccuracies or errors, especially if the data they were trained on is outdated or incomplete. Checking the accuracy of the information provided can help identify AI-generated content. Inconsistent or incorrect facts are often a sign of machine-generated text.

Techniques for Detecting AI-Generated Text

1. Use AI Detection Tools

Several tools and platforms are specifically designed to detect AI-generated content. These tools analyze text for patterns typical of machine-generated writing and can provide a likelihood score indicating whether the text was created by an AI. Examples include GPT-2 Output Detector and OpenAI's own AI detection tools.

2. Manual Analysis of Writing Style

Conducting a manual analysis of the writing style can be effective. Look for signs of unnatural phrasing, awkward sentence structures, or a lack of personal touch. Compare the text against known human-written content to spot discrepancies in style or tone.

3. Analyze Context and Relevance

AI-generated text may sometimes lack contextual relevance or fail to address specific nuances of a topic. Evaluate whether the content directly answers the intended query or if it seems generic. Human writers typically provide more tailored and contextually relevant responses.

4. Review Source and Attribution

Check the source of the content and its attribution. AI tools often generate content without proper citation or acknowledgment of sources. If the text lacks credible references or appears to have been pulled from various sources without proper attribution, it might be AI-generated.
